The Role of Customer Satisfaction in Emotional Marketing Success

Customer satisfaction plays a significant role in determining the effectiveness of emotional marketing strategies. Emotional branding aims to create a strong emotional connection between the brand and the customer, leading to increased customer loyalty. However, without measuring customer satisfaction, it is difficult to assess whether emotional marketing efforts are successful in achieving this goal.

By tracking and analysing customer satisfaction metrics, businesses can gain valuable insights into how well their emotional marketing strategies resonate with customers.

One key metric for measuring customer satisfaction is Net Promoter Score (NPS), which measures how likely customers are to recommend a brand to others. A high NPS indicates that customers are satisfied with their experience and have developed a strong emotional connection with the brand. Other metrics such as Customer Satisfaction Score (CSAT) and Customer Effort Score (CES) also provide valuable information about customer satisfaction levels.

Measuring the Impact of Emotional Marketing on Brand Loyalty

Measuring the impact of emotional marketing on brand loyalty involves evaluating the effectiveness of strategies in fostering lasting connections between brands and consumers. Emotional loyalty can be measured through various key metrics such as customer satisfaction, repeat purchases, and brand advocacy. These metrics provide insights into the success of emotional marketing campaigns in driving consumer behaviour and influencing sales.

Customer satisfaction is a crucial metric for measuring emotional loyalty as it reflects the extent to which customers feel emotionally connected to a brand. Repeat purchases indicate that customers are not only satisfied with their previous experiences but also have developed a sense of loyalty towards the brand. Brand advocacy measures the level of positive word-of-mouth recommendations from customers, indicating their emotional attachment and willingness to promote the brand.

The table below illustrates how these key metrics can be used to measure emotional loyalty:

Key MetricDefinitionImportance
Customer SatisfactionThe degree to which customers are satisfied with their overall experience with a brandIndicates emotional connection and likelihood of future engagement
Repeat PurchasesThe number of times a customer makes a purchase from a particular brand within a given time periodReflects trust, loyalty, and continued emotional attachment
Brand AdvocacyThe likelihood that customers will recommend or promote a brand to othersDemonstrates strong emotional connection and positive sentiment towards the brand

Measuring Emotional Engagement

Emotional engagement can be assessed through various metrics to gauge the effectiveness of emotional marketing strategies. Measuring emotional impact is crucial in understanding how consumers respond to marketing campaigns and identifying areas for improvement.

There are several key metrics that can be used to evaluate emotional engagement, including:

  1. Click-through rate (CTR): This metric measures the percentage of users who clicked on a specific call-to-action or advertisement. A high CTR indicates strong emotional resonance and interest among viewers.
  2. Conversion rate: Conversion rate measures the percentage of users who take a desired action, such as making a purchase or signing up for a newsletter. Higher conversion rates indicate successful emotional engagement strategies.
  3. Social media sentiment analysis: By analysing social media mentions and comments, marketers can gain insights into the public’s emotional response towards their campaigns.
  4. Brand loyalty: Measuring brand loyalty through repeat purchases, customer retention rates, and surveys can provide valuable information on emotional engagement levels.

Analysing Social Media Sentiment

Social media sentiment analysis provides marketers with valuable insights into the public’s emotional response towards their campaigns. By analysing user-generated content on social media platforms, sentiment analysis techniques allow marketers to understand how their campaigns are being perceived and received by the target audience. This data-driven approach helps marketers make informed decisions regarding campaign adjustments and optimisations.

Incorporating emotional marketing strategies can greatly impact a campaign’s success. Emotional marketing case studies have shown that evoking positive emotions such as happiness, excitement, or inspiration can lead to increased brand loyalty, customer engagement, and conversion rates. On the other hand, negative emotions like anger or sadness may negatively impact brand perception and customer satisfaction.

To analyse social media sentiment effectively, marketers can utilise various techniques such as natural language processing algorithms and machine learning models. These methods enable the identification of sentiments expressed in textual data through sentiment classification (positive, negative, neutral) and emotion detection (joy, anger, fear). By leveraging these techniques alongside emotional marketing strategies, marketers can optimise their campaigns for greater success.

Measuring Emotional Response?

To accurately measure the impact of emotional triggers in advertising campaigns, researchers and marketers can employ various quantitative and qualitative research methods that focus on analysing consumer responses and behaviours.

These methods allow for a deeper understanding of how individuals emotionally engage with marketing messages, as well as the effectiveness of emotional marketing strategies.

Quantitative approaches involve gathering numerical data through surveys or experiments to assess emotional response levels and their correlation with desired outcomes such as purchase intent or brand loyalty.

Qualitative techniques, on the other hand, rely on interviews, focus groups, or observational studies to capture more nuanced insights into consumers’ emotions and motivations.
